usb hub hi and slow speed devices problems

Sun Dec 16, 2012 10:34 pm

hi guys!

i seem to have a problem with my pi, i have a powered usb hub and i have on it a usb memory stick, my usb keyboard/mouse and a usb-serial converter

im running lxde and every so often the usb stick dissapears and comes back and i get a box on lxde saying 'removable hardware device inserted what do i want to do with it' and when this happens it crashs all my other devices on the same hub! but they then come back! if i remove the memory stick and put it straight into the usb port on the pi its ok and no problems

the only thing i can think is memory stick is a fast device and the others are not!

any 1 had simular problems or know how to resolve????

Yes this is a well known problem which has still not been fixed. Mixing high speed and low speed
devices doesn't work unless you force everything to be lo-speed.

I get random disconnects of memory sticks and usb HDDs. Its very annoying and makes some
obvious projects like a media player or a music server unworkable..You can never predict when the
HDD or memory stick is going to disconnect.
